Output e5fb9cac094e36c15ca5409fae17f6deb2ba1a122192c3faaa9c5840a29bf0a9:53

value
13742033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e7d093cc80c1c88796cb0b2ef5dbe60c5ff3c73 OP_EQUAL
address
MDbZuyyKHYNvq8hxStgELuRhCipvSJEgWx
transaction
e5fb9cac094e36c15ca5409fae17f6deb2ba1a122192c3faaa9c5840a29bf0a9
spent
true